The Earth's core is made up of metals, primarily iron and nickel, due to their high density and ability to sink towards the center during the early stages of the Earth's formation when the planet was molten. This heavy metal composition plays a crucial role in generating the Earth's magnetic field through the movement of molten metals in the core.
